Sidewalks are expensive. Concrete is expensive. Engineering designs are expensive. Construction companies are expensive. Get over it. These projects must be awarded to the LOWEST BIDDER, BY LAW. There are standards the city has for these things, so it is not some knucklehead contractor doing this kind of work. Then there is the street issue. Do you put sidewalks on a street that is planned to be torn up, and then have to remove the sidewalks, in a year or two, or do you do it all at once. For years this city has granted variances to developers to build their projects without sidewalks, but that does not happen now, it is a requirement of our new code. That is why we need sidewalks all across this city, because we allowed developers to eliminate them and we did not make this a priority in our development standards and future infrastructure investments.
